Why We Celebrate National Yoga Month
Every September, the yoga community comes together to celebrate National Yoga Month — a dedicated time to promote the physical, mental, and emotional benefits of yoga. Launched by the Department of Health & Human Services, this month-long celebration is about more than just movement; it’s about mindful living, self-discovery, and holistic well-being.

Curious About Yoga? Try These Styles:
If you’re new to yoga (or just want to try something new), this month is a great time to explore different types of practice. Here are a few popular styles and what to expect:
Heated Vinyasa Flow
-
What it is: A dynamic, fast-paced class linking breath to movement — usually in a room heated to 90–105°F.
-
Perfect for: Anyone who loves to sweat, build strength, and feel energized.
-
Gear tip: You’ll need a non-slip towel to stay grounded. (We’ve got you covered.)
Bikram Yoga
-
What it is: A traditional hot yoga sequence of 26 poses practiced in a 105°F room with 40% humidity.
-
Perfect for: Structured practitioners who love consistency and deep physical detox.
-
Gear tip: Bikram gets sweaty. Bring two towels — one for your mat, one for your face.
Yin Yoga
-
What it is: A slow, meditative style of yoga where poses are held for 3–5 minutes.
-
Perfect for: Deep tissue release, nervous system regulation, and reconnecting with stillness.
-
Gear tip: Supportive props (blocks, bolsters) + a soft towel to lay over your mat = dreamy.
